Abstract
The practical development of this master's thesis took place in the months of October and November 2023. Welding processes were carried out using equipment from “stirtec,” installed at the EuroDies Italia Srl’workshop located in Rivoli (TO). All laboratory tests were conducted at the J-Tech laboratory located at the main campus of the Polytechnic University of Turin. The thesis focuses on the application of the passive repair process for filler friction on AISI 304 alloy. The joining process used is Friction Stir Welding (FSW), which offers significant advantages in terms of joint strength and quality. The main material used for the experiments is AISI 304 steel, known for its strength and ductility.
Experimental tests were conducted following the specifications of JIS G 3136, with particular attention to the geometry of the test samples and optimal welding conditions
